Teriyaki Madness Opens July 1 at Kapolei Commons

We were able to get a sneak peek at the first Hawaiʻi location of Teriyaki Madness — it opens Wednesday, July 1, on the Ross side of Kapolei Commons shopping center.

The Seattle-style teriyaki chain is known for:

  • Using fresh vegetables and meat — none of the food is frozen.
  • Everything’s cooked to order — not a buffet
  • Big portions that are weighed exactly before cooking

Bowls come with your choice of protein (chicken, salmon, etc.), base (rice, noodles, or all veggies), and optional sides. One thing that will be unique to this first Hawaiʻi location — mac salad is on the menu.

Teriyaki Madness has more than 100 locations nationwide — including a dozen in Vegas, so locals who’ve lived or visited family there already know about it.

The Kapolei location is much larger than the typical Teriyaki Madness, with family-style seating for big groups (observing social distancing regulations, of course).

Local entrepreneur and franchise owner Ohmar Villavicencio completely remodeled the space (formerly it was the smaller Genki Sushi, before they moved to their newer spot). All the flooring, furniture, and kitchen equipment is new — along with local decor like a traditional Hawaiian proverb.
